  • Patent number: 9746599
    Abstract: A display device includes: a display panel including a display region and a peripheral region; a transparent protector disposed to cover the display panel; a bezel print pattern disposed between the display panel and the transparent protector and configured to form a light shield region corresponding to the peripheral region; at least one light guide film disposed between the display panel and the bezel ink pattern in the light shield region; an ultraviolet (UV)-proof printed circuit board (PCB) disposed between the display panel and the light guide film and in contact with the light guide film; and a UV curing layer formed between the display panel and the transparent protector.

  • Patent number: 9676162
    Abstract: A display device, including a display panel including a display area and a non-display area, the non-display area surrounding the display area; a window facing the display panel and including a light-transmitting area and a light-blocking area, the light-transmitting area corresponding to the display area, and the light-blocking area corresponding to the non-display area; and a plurality of printed layers on the window in the light-blocking area, each printed layer including an isocyanate-blocking group having a different dissociation temperature from isocyanate-blocking groups included in other printed layers.

  • Patent number: 9526166
    Abstract: A bezel structure for a display device includes a first resin layer capable of being cured by ultraviolet radiation, an ink layer including a non-volatile solvent disposed on the first resin layer, a second resin layer disposed in the ink layer, and an upper structure disposed on the ink layer. The second resin layer prevents an uncured portion of the first resin layer from permeating into a cavity in the ink layer.

  • Publication number: 20100193351
    Abstract: A method for preparing a transparent conducting film coated with an AZO/Ag/AZO multilayer thin film with low resistivity and high light transmittance, and a transparent conducting film produced by the same method. The method for preparing a transparent conducting film coated with an AZO/Ag/AZO multilayer thin film, includes (a) forming a primary AZO thin film on a substrate using an AZO target doped with Al through a sputtering method; (b) depositing Ag on the primary AZO thin film using the sputtering method to form a deposited Ag layer; and (c) forming a secondary AZO thin film on the Ag thin film using the AZO target doped with Al through a sputtering method.

  • Patent number: 6047792
    Abstract: Disclosed is an elevator having covers capable of minimizing a generation of turbulent flows at upper and lower portions of the elevator cabin so as to reduce noise and vibration during the operation of the elevator. The elevator according to the present invention comprises upper and lower horizontal supporting members made of shaped steels having a L shape in cross section and plate strips, and covers having a dome and a truncated pyramid shape. In the elevator according to the present invention, the covers can temper impacts, due to air flows in a hoistway, against the elevator cabin during the operation of the elevator. As a result, noise and vibration due to the impacts can be reduced.
